Internship Opportunities

UNC Asheville’s Department of Languages and Literatures offers summer internships through the Spanish Internship (SPAN 401), where students earn course credit while working with local organizations that serve Spanish-speaking communities. These experiences allow students to apply their classroom learning in real-world settings such as healthcare, education, journalism, marketing, legal services, and community outreach, while also building professional skills, strengthening communication, and preparing for future academic or career opportunities.

Student Clubs & Activities

Put your German skills into action with the German Club, which holds Kaffee und Kuchen, a biweekly event welcome to all levels of German speakers, as well as a monthly German Film Night.

Students can also engage with the French Conversation Table, another fun option for students to practice their language skills with others and foster connections with their peers.
